Product Overview

Category: Schottky Diode
Use: Rectification, voltage clamping, and protection in power supply and other electronic equipment
Characteristics: Low forward voltage drop, high current capability, fast switching speed
Package: DO-214AC (SMA) package
Essence: High-efficiency rectification and voltage clamping
Packaging/Quantity: Tape & Reel, 3000 units per reel

Specifications

  • Forward Voltage Drop: 0.55V at 1A
  • Reverse Voltage: 50V
  • Average Rectified Current: 1A
  • Peak Forward Surge Current: 30A
  • Operating Temperature Range: -65°C to +125°C

Working Principles

The VS-11DQ05 operates based on the Schottky barrier principle, where the metal-semiconductor junction allows for faster switching and lower forward voltage drop compared to conventional diodes.
